    Cambridge HFT

    As people may or may not be aware Shepreth Airgun Club will have its final shoot on Sunday 19th December due to the guys that started it not having the time to carry on running it any longer. The club will be reincarnated under a new name called

    Cambridge HFT Airgun Club

    otherwise known as

    Cambridge HFT

    A new committee headed by myself and a wonderful team of people will do our best to carry on running the club and try and improve the club. We have a busy time ahead of us as none of us have run an airgun club before but I am sure we will do the club justice.
